The Role of RAM in Gaming

RAM, or Random Access Memory, is an essential component in gaming PCs. It temporarily stores data that the CPU and GPU need while gaming, allowing for quick access and processing. Having adequate RAM directly influences how many applications can run simultaneously, affecting everything from loading times to game performance.

Here are a few critical points about RAM's role in gaming:

  • Performance: More RAM often leads to reduced stuttering and smoother frame rates in games. It is particularly beneficial when playing games that require substantial memory, like those with large open worlds or detailed graphics.
  • Multitasking: Gamers often run background applications, such as streaming software or voice chat services. Adequate RAM ensures that these applications do not interfere with the gaming experience.
  • Future Compatibility: As games evolve, their memory requirements tend to increase. Having a gaming PC with 16GB of RAM, for example, can ensure that the system remains relevant as newer titles are released.

Comparative Analysis of RAM Capacities

4GB Versus 8GB

A common entry point for many gaming PCs is 4GB of RAM. However, this capacity is often inadequate for demanding applications. Titles will likely struggle, and stuttering may occur. On the other hand, 8GB offers improved performance. Many gamers find this augmentation necessary for comfortable play, especially with mid-range games.

While 8GB does allow for better multitasking and load times, it remains close to the edge for more resource-heavy games. The advantage of 8GB is its cost-effectiveness, making it a popular choice among budget-conscious gamers. However, players aiming for longevity in their gaming system may consider 16GB more advantageous.

16GB Versus 32GB

When comparing 16GB to 32GB, the competitive edge of 16GB emerges clearly for most gamers. While 32GB caters to specialized needs, such as high-end content creation or intensive simulation games, the average gaming scenario does not demand such expansive memory. Most titles run flawlessly on 16GB, with adequate headroom to manage multitasking.

Key Characteristics of 32GB:

  • Ideal for professional streaming and content creation
  • Future-proofing for emerging gaming technologies
  • Enhanced performance in extensive applications

Nonetheless, the higher price point of 32GB does not necessarily guarantee better performance in the majority of gaming scenarios. For most users, 16GB strikes the right balance between cost and performance, making it a profound choice in today's gaming PCs.

Processor Compatibility

The processor, or CPU, is arguably the heart of a gaming PC. It performs all the calculations necessary for the operations executed within the system, affecting not only gaming but multitasking capabilities as well. When selecting a CPU, factors such as the number of cores and threads, clock speed, and generation matters highly.

Most modern games benefit from processors that have multiple cores. A quad-core processor has become the minimum standard, while many titles can take advantage of six or even eight cores. Brands like Intel and AMD each offer different models that can pair effectively with 16GB of RAM.

Choosing the right CPU involves:

  • Ensuring it fits within your budget while meeting your gaming needs.
  • Checking compatibility with your selected motherboard since different sockets support different processors.
  • Considering future upgradeability to avoid a bottleneck in performance.

Storage Options and their Impact

Storage in gaming PCs has evolved, with SSDs becoming increasingly popular for their faster load times compared to traditional HDDs. For a gaming setup with 16GB RAM, balancing both types of storage can enhance performance.

When choosing storage, keep these factors in mind:

  • SSDs significantly reduce game load times. NVMe SSDs are even faster than SATA SSDs but can come at a higher price.
  • HDDs can be large and cost-effective if you need additional space for bulk media or games that do not require frequent loading.
  • Consider how much storage you realistically need based on your game library and other software.

Effective selection of storage can create a smoother gaming experience while managing available resources better.

Game Settings and RAM Usage

Game settings play a significant role in how RAM is utilized during gameplay. Higher settings, such as ultra graphics or extensive draw distances, often require more RAM to maintain seamless performance. In most cases, modern games spectrum from requiring a minimum of 8GB RAM to the recommended 16GB or even higher for optimal functioning.

When players opt for higher textures and advanced effects, they should expect their gaming rigs to tap into that extra RAM more efficiently. The smooth performance becomes less about FPS drops and more about having enough breathing room for other processes, especially with background applications. Here are some vital points to consider:

  • Texture Quality: Higher textures require more memory, hence can lead to stutter if insufficient RAM is available.
  • Resolution: Greater resolution demands more resources, engaging more RAM to keep frame rates consistent.
  • Background Applications: Additional programs running can consume RAM and consequently reduce the gaming performance.

Performance Tip: Adjusting in-game settings can help gauge which configurations effectively tax your RAM, fine-tuning your system.

Scalability Options with RAM

Scalability is another vital aspect of future-proofing your gaming PC. With technology advancing rapidly, having a system that can expand its capabilities is advantageous. Consider RAM options that allow easy upgrades. Many motherboards support various configurations of RAM. This enables you to increase your RAM from 16GB to 32GB or more as needed.

There are a few things to keep in mind:

  • Type of RAM: Ensure that your motherboard can accept the type of RAM you wish to install in the future.
  • Number of Slots: Check how many RAM slots your motherboard has. Systems with more slots mean better options for future upgrades.
  • Compatibility: Not all RAM is equal. It's crucial to ensure that any additional RAM is compatible with your existing components.

By strategizing wisely about scalability, you secure more investment into your gaming setup. This part of planning will save you time and costs down the line, as upgrading becomes less cumbersome.

Dispelling Myths Surrounding RAM Sizes

One prevalent myth is that more RAM always equals better gaming performance. While it is true that sufficient RAM is needed for smooth gameplay, simply increasing the RAM size beyond a certain point offers diminishing returns. For most gamers, 16GB is optimal for handling modern titles efficiently. Upgrading to 32GB may not yield significant performance benefits unless you engage in memory-intensive tasks like video editing or running virtual machines.

Another misconception is that less popular RAM sizes, like 8GB, can fully support today's demanding games. This is often not the case. Many games now recommend at least 16GB to ensure smooth loading times and to avoid stutter during gameplay. It is crucial to match RAM size with both the game requirements and the specific use cases of your gaming setup.

For instance, if you play a mix of gaming and resource-heavy applications, 16GB is a safe balance. Thus, while stronger systems may handle lower RAM sizes, gamers aiming for an optimal experience should recognize the value of sufficient memory.

Understanding the Impact of RAM Speed

Another key area often misunderstood is the speed of RAM. Many people think higher-speed RAM is always better for gaming. In reality, the perceived benefits usually depend on the components in the system. For most mainstream gaming scenarios, the difference between 2400 MHz and 3200 MHz RAM may not be substantial. Both settings can execute tasks adequately.

However, the impact of RAM speed can be highlighted when coupled with high-performance CPUs. In such scenarios, faster RAM can improve frame rates and loading times. But, it is critical to note that returns on investment drop as speed increases drastically. Balancing RAM speed with the overall architecture of the gaming PC is vital for maximizing performance. Make sure the motherboard supports the RAM speed, as this integration is crucial.

RAM is an important component that does impact overall gaming performance, but it is not the sole factor. Balance between size, speed, and the entire assembly is essential.
